About Creative Support

Creative Support is one of England’s leading not-for-profit providers of care and prevention services, working in over 70 local authority areas nationwide. Its mission is to promote independence, inclusion and wellbeing by delivering high-quality, person-centred support in partnership with individuals, families and local communities.

Each year, Creative Support helps thousands of people with care needs to achieve their goals and live fulfilling lives, while also providing quality housing with support for over 1,400 tenants. With more than 5,000 staff, the organisation is committed to co-production, partnership working and continuous staff development through its award-winning Creative Academy.

Creative Support is an Investors in People Gold employer, a Stonewall Diversity Champion, and proudly holds the Disability Confident accreditation.

About the Role:

Creative Support is seeking warm, reliable, and proactive Support Workers to join our friendly team in Blackpool, Lancashire. We provide quality care and support for individuals with learning disability higher needs in a vibrant service where no two days are the same. VISA Sponsorship will be considered for post holders dependent upon completion of the probationary period.

Duties

  • You will support service users in various activities, including employment, volunteering, community engagement, and daily living tasks at home. We are looking for someone with a great sense of humor who enjoys being part of an energetic team.
  • Your role includes encouraging service users to engage in exciting social activities both within and outside their homes and developing warm, trusting relationships with service users and their families, ensuring they enjoy their time to the fullest.

We offer both full-time and part-time hours with a willingness to work sleep-ins and cover various shift patterns (early, mid, late).

We welcome candidates from all backgrounds. No previous care experience is necessary, just a passion for providing person-centered care and support in a bright, friendly environment.
